Overview of Shipping to China from United Arab Emirates

Shipping from the United Arab Emirates to China represents a vital artery in global trade, fueled by the exchange of UAE's petrochemicals, machinery, and aluminum for China's consumer goods, electronics, and textiles. Primary departure points are Jebel Ali Free Zone Port (JEA) in Dubai and ports in Abu Dhabi, which handle the bulk of eastbound volumes. These connect to China's major gateways: Shanghai (SHG), Ningbo (NGB), and Qingdao, via reliable carriers operating direct services or transshipments through hubs like Singapore.

In 2025-2026, this route enjoys stable conditions on Asia-Middle East lanes, though exporters must account for potential Red Sea disruptions rerouting via Cape of Good Hope (adding 7-10 days) and peak seasons like Chinese New Year (late January to mid-February), when volumes surge and rates spike. We've managed thousands of shipments on this corridor from our Hong Kong hub, observing that door-to-door timelines include 3-7 days for China customs clearance, making proactive planning essential. Moderate eastbound volumes keep rates competitive compared to the busier westbound flows, offering opportunities for cost savings through consolidation and forward planning.

Trade data underscores the route's importance: UAE-China bilateral trade exceeded $80 billion in recent years, with sea freight dominating 70-80% of non-urgent cargo. Sea FCL (Full Container Load)

Ideal for shipments exceeding 10 CBM, such as machinery, textiles, or bulk commodities, Sea FCL offers dedicated 20ft or 40ft containers from Jebel Ali to Shanghai. Direct routes take 18-25 days port-to-port, with carriers providing weekly sailings. Advantages include lower per-CBM costs ($75-175 for 20ft), security for high-value loads, and flexibility for oversized cargo. However, minimum volumes apply, and peak seasons inflate rates by 20-50%.

Sea LCL (Less than Container Load)

For volumes under 10 CBM, LCL consolidates your freight with others at Jebel Ali hubs, shipping to China ports like Ningbo. Transit is 20-30 days, with costs at $150-300 per CBM (minimum 2 CBM). It's cost-effective for SMEs shipping samples or partial loads, but dwell times at consolidation yards add variability.

Air Freight

High-value or time-sensitive goods like electronics, perishables, or pharmaceuticals demand air freight from Dubai International (DXB) to Pudong (PVG) or Shanghai (SHA). Rates range $3-6 per kg for 100kg+ consolidations, with 3-6 days port-to-port. Capacity is ample on daily flights, but fuel volatility drives surcharges.

Express/Courier

For parcels under 150kg, express services offer door-to-door convenience in 2-5 days at $8-15 per kg. Suited for documents, samples, or urgent spares, with full tracking.

Choose this for speed over volume, though it's 5-10x costlier than sea.

Introduction of the China Customs Regulations

China's customs landscape, governed by the General Administration of Customs (GACC), emphasizes digital efficiency via its single-window system. As of 2025, pre-arrival declarations (24-168 hours prior) and 10-digit HS codes are mandatory, filed electronically. Duties average 7-8% MFN on CIF value, plus 13% VAT and consumption taxes for luxuries.

The UAE-China CEPA (2024) delivers phased tariff cuts on select HS codes—verify via official tools. Clearance typically spans 1-7 days, but CIQ inspections for food/agriculture extend to 30 days. Importers require registered entities; electronics need CCC certification. Non-compliance invites fines or seizure. Prohibited & Restricted Items for shipping from United Arab Emirates to China

Navigating prohibitions and restrictions is crucial to avoid seizures. Per GACC guidelines:

  • Prohibited: Arms, explosives, narcotics, counterfeit currency, obscene materials, unpermitted plants/animals, waste, right-wing publications.

Restricted (permits required):

  • Food/agriculture (CIQ approval)
  • Chemicals/pharma (MOFCOM licenses)
  • Electronics (CCC/SRRC certs)
  • Dual-use goods (2025/26 export control list)
  • Ivory/relics, silver/tungsten (quotas)
  • 2026 additions: Grains, live cattle
